Astronaut: 20% Becoming an astronaut requires a strong educational background in engineering, biological sciences, or physical sciences, along with excellent physical health and teamwork skills. Astronauts play a crucial role in conducting experiments and gathering data during space missions, all while adhering to strict ethical guidelines. 2. Space Engineer: 30% Space engineers design, build, and maintain spacecraft, satellites, and space stations. Their work involves creating innovative solutions while considering environmental, safety, and social implications, ensuring that space exploration benefits society as a whole. 3. Aerospace Engineer: 25% Aerospace engineers specialize in designing, manufacturing, and testing aircraft, missiles, and spacecraft. Their expertise in aerodynamics, propulsion, and materials science enables them to create efficient and sustainable vehicles that minimize harm to the Earth and its inhabitants. 4. Space Scientist: 15% Space scientists conduct research in various disciplines, including astronomy, astrophysics, and planetary science. They contribute to our understanding of the universe, often uncovering new ethical dilemmas related to extraterrestrial life, resource management, and space colonization. 5. Space Lawyer: 10% Space lawyers navigate the complex legal landscape surrounding space exploration, ensuring that organizations comply with international treaties and regulations. They also work on drafting new laws and policies that promote ethical conduct and responsible use of outer space.
